(Free) The Role of Design Systems in Streamlining Workflow and Enhancing Consistency

In the fast-paced world of design, maintaining consistency across digital products and platforms can be a daunting challenge.

Feb 17, 2024

In the fast-paced world of design, maintaining consistency across digital products and platforms can be a daunting challenge. Enter design systems—a comprehensive collection of reusable components, patterns, and guidelines that streamline workflow and ensure visual coherence across all touchpoints. In this article, we'll explore the role of design systems in modern design workflows, their benefits, and practical strategies for implementing and maintaining them effectively.

Understanding Design Systems:

A design system is a centralized repository of design assets, including UI components, typography, colors, and guidelines, that serves as a single source of truth for design teams. It provides a systematic approach to design, enabling teams to create cohesive, scalable, and consistent experiences across various projects and platforms.

Key Components of Design Systems:


  1. UI Components: Design systems include a library of reusable UI components, such as buttons, forms, cards, and navigation elements, that can be easily implemented and customized across different interfaces.

  2. Typography and Colors: Design systems establish guidelines for typography and color usage, ensuring visual consistency and brand coherence across all design assets.

  3. Guidelines and Best Practices: Design systems include documentation that outlines design principles, guidelines, and best practices to ensure alignment with brand standards and design objectives.

Benefits of Design Systems:


  • Consistency: Design systems promote consistency by providing a standardized set of design elements and guidelines that ensure uniformity across all touchpoints.

  • Efficiency: By reusing components and patterns, design systems streamline workflow and reduce duplication of effort, saving time and resources.

  • Scalability: Design systems scale seamlessly as projects grow, allowing teams to maintain visual coherence and consistency across various platforms and devices.

  • Collaboration: Design systems foster collaboration and alignment among cross-functional teams by providing a shared language and understanding of design principles and guidelines.

Practical Strategies for Implementing Design Systems:


  1. Define Design Principles: Establish clear design principles that align with your brand identity and objectives to guide the development of your design system.

  2. Create a Component Library: Build a comprehensive library of reusable UI components, patterns, and templates that adhere to your design principles and guidelines.

  3. Document Guidelines and Best Practices: Document design guidelines, best practices, and usage guidelines to ensure consistency and alignment across design teams.

  4. Iterate and Evolve: Continuously iterate and evolve your design system based on user feedback, design trends, and evolving business needs to keep it relevant and effective.

Conclusion:

Design systems play a crucial role in streamlining workflow, enhancing consistency, and fostering collaboration in modern design workflows. By providing a centralized repository of design assets, guidelines, and best practices, design systems empower teams to create cohesive, scalable, and impactful experiences across various projects and platforms. Whether you're a small design team or a large enterprise, embracing design systems can lead to more efficient, consistent, and successful design outcomes.

Blog

Similar Articles

Blog

Similar Articles

Course

Get Access to my full course

Start your journey of mastering Framer with 9 FREE Lessons!

Course

Get Access to my full course

Start your journey of mastering Framer with 9 FREE Lessons!

1.1: Introduction to Framer

Free

1.1: Introduction to Framer

Free

1.2: Fundamentals of Framer

Free

1.2: Fundamentals of Framer

Free

1.3: Layout, Sizing & Positioning

Free

1.3: Layout, Sizing & Positioning

Free

Fundamentals

3 Lessons

1.1: Introduction to Framer

Free

1.2: Fundamentals of Framer

Free

1.3: Layout, Sizing & Positioning

Free

Fundamentals

3 Lessons

2.1: How to use Breakpoints

2.1: How to use Breakpoints

2.2: Using Aspect Ratio

2.2: Using Aspect Ratio

2.3: How to use Viewport Height.

2.3: How to use Viewport Height.

Design & Layout

3 Lessons

3.1: Create reuasble components

3.1: Create reuasble components

3.2: Create interactive Carousels

3.2: Create interactive Carousels

3.3: Code Overrides

3.3: Code Overrides

Components

3 Lessons

4.1: build a rotating grid on scroll

4.1: build a rotating grid on scroll

4.2: Creating zooming scroll effects like Apple.com

4.2: Creating zooming scroll effects like Apple.com

4.3: Creating a canvas-like website with draggable elements

4.3: Creating a canvas-like website with draggable elements

Animations

3 Lessons

5.1: Managing content with Framer’s built-in CMS.

5.1: Managing content with Framer’s built-in CMS.

5.2: Use bold and italic fonts in the CMS content editor

5.2: Use bold and italic fonts in the CMS content editor

5.3: Using Conditionals & Transforms in your CMS fieds

5.3: Using Conditionals & Transforms in your CMS fieds

CMS

3 Lessons

2.1: How to use Breakpoints

2.2: Using Aspect Ratio

2.3: How to use Viewport Height.

Design & Layout

3 Lessons

3.1: Create reuasble components

3.2: Create interactive Carousels

3.3: Code Overrides

Components

3 Lessons

4.1: build a rotating grid on scroll

4.2: Creating zooming scroll effects like Apple.com

4.3: Creating a canvas-like website with draggable elements

Animations

3 Lessons

5.1: Managing content with Framer’s built-in CMS.

5.2: Use bold and italic fonts in the CMS content editor

5.3: Using Conditionals & Transforms in your CMS fieds

CMS

3 Lessons